DCOM stands to primarily promote and advocate digital commerce (both internet and mobile) in the country. Its mission is to make Filipino merchants globally competitive in digital commerce space through:
1. Establishing standards and best practices for a friendly and secured digital commerce industry.
2. Teaching Filipino merchants how to properly leverage on digital commerce.
3. making the Philippines digital commerce industry attractive for trade and investments.
4. Partnering with government in shaping sound policies on digital commerce.
DCOM has just been registered in SEC last January 27, 2012 only and is currently in the process of drafting its Program of Activities for the Year, as well as simultaneously drafting the Membership Guidelines, which will impact the proposed industry 'Trust Seal' for bonafide online merchants and the establishment of Industry Standards, Code of Ethics and Best Practices for digital commerce (internet and mobile) in the Philippines.
